Ex-President Perez dies in Miami

Venezuela's former president Carlos Andres Perez has died suddenly in Miami aged 88. Perez was responsible for nationlising the country's oil industry during the 1970s. He then survived a coup attempt by current president, Hugo Chavez, before being driven out of office on corruption charges.

His daughter told the Globovision television network, that her father had woken in good spirits on Christmas day, but died unexpectedly from a suspected heart attack later that day.

Perez served twice as Venezuela's president. During his first term, from 1974 to 1979, he oversaw the formation of the state-run Petroleos de Venezuela, which allowed the oil-rich nation to benefit dramatically from the soaring energy prices of the early 1970s.

Just weeks after his victory in the 1988 election for his second term, Perez hammered out a deal with the International Monetary Fund to introduce more free market policies in order to secure a multi-billion dollar loan to help pay down Venezuela's external debt. After he was sworn in on February 1989, there were massive street riots to protest the economic reforms.

The uprising, known as Caracazo, was the strongest anti-government protest in modern Venezulan history. It was repressed by force killing 276 people.

In 1992, Hugo Chavez, then a little-knpwn army lieutenant colonel, led an unsuccessful military coup several years before being democratically elected to lead the country.

Perez survived another coup attempt later than year, but in March 1993, the attorney general called on the Supreme Court to impeach the president for misappropriation and embezzlement of some 17 million dollars.

In 2005, Caracas asked Washington to extradite Perez on charges related to the deaths during the Caracaza.
